Lean Principle applied in Agile

- Programmers write more automated testes and focus on higher automated testing  - Manual testers are more focused on exploratory testing  - Documentation of BRS, FRS, Test Plans are totally reduced to a simple list of features with scenarios; i.e. BDD. This provides a common language that business users, programmers, testers can all understand share and collaborate on.  - Development Team is structured that programmer and testing skills are in the team.Instead team members pair up to both do development and testing in a highly iterative and incremental nature.  - Culturally the team succeeds when the work is done and meets the quality standards defined by the "Definition of Done".
